Cops on rooftops Friday for Special Olympics

For the 14th year, hundreds of Illinois law enforcement officers will stake out Dunkin' Donuts rooftops Friday morning to benefit Special Olympics Illinois. Starting at 5 a.m., officers will climb onto 225 Dunkin' Donuts rooftops to take donations for the Torch Run, law enforcement's special fundraising arm for Special Olympics. Officers hope to top last year's $540,000 total. Donors will get a free doughnut coupon; those who donate at least $10 will get a Law Enforcement Torch Run travel mug (while supplies last) and a coffee coupon. Torch Run T-shirts and hats will be sold. For a list of participating locations, see www.facebook.com/DunkinChicago or www.facebook.com/SpecialOlympicsIllinois.
